Output ffc2761b34a8ba40c509e9c0052dce4bd11c79924477173aa339262e5eb84eb8:53

value
43850139
script pubkey
OP_0 OP_PUSHBYTES_32 ca8e86d3f967694aea268082040f1669b44a151dea2dc1e553798a34a4fde65b
address
bc1qe28gd5leva55463xszpqgrckdx6y59gaagkure2n0x9rff8aueds2rl3tw
transaction
ffc2761b34a8ba40c509e9c0052dce4bd11c79924477173aa339262e5eb84eb8
spent
true